PRESENT CONTINUOUS 1 .-  We use the present continuous to talk about   actions that are already going on at the moment of speaking . I am playing football now 2.- We use it to talk about  temporary actions or situations . I am working in London this summer  I am living in London this year 3.- We use the present continuous to talk about   something that is in progress around the present, but not necessarily at the moment of speaking. She is looking for a job at the moment  You are spending a lot of money these days 4.- We also use it to talk about  future happenings . I am going to London this weekend  I’m visiting my parents on Saturday SPELLING Some verbs ending in 1 vowel+1 consonant   Verbs ending in  e   Most verbs Run- running  dance- dancing  work ing Swim- swimming  live- living  playing Sit-sitting  come- coming  learning Time expressions  with present continuous:  now, at the moment, at present.
